Capital-G "God" is the one true almighty existence responsible for everything in the universe, including but not limited to its very creation.
Lower-case "gods" come in sets and have much more limited powers, although they are still far and beyond the realm of mortal capabilities. They can be partially involved/responsible for creation myths involving the world or even universe, but are never solely responsible.
The difference between God and a god is quite massive.
